I've been chasing this issue for a while now and I've finally gotten fed up with up. I did a search and didn't find what I was looking for. So here's the issue: When I start my Ty cold, let the pump prime for a few seconds then turn the key, it fires right up after about half of a crack. Now if I let the truck idle for a few minutes to warm up, or go for a long ride (doesn't matter) and I try starting truck up again a short period thereafter it gives me a hard time starting. It will crank and poof as if to try to start then keep cranking... If I hold the throttle wide open it will crank then eventually start, run rough, rev it a few times and sometimes it will clear out. Sometimes it keeps running like it's flooded with fuel and wants to shut off. It idles and runs fine normally, doesn't appear to be running rich or dumping fuel prior to this happening.
A few times in the past the only way I could get truck to re-fire was to hook it up to jumper cables, or a battery charger. It was as if the extra kick at the battery was enough to fire the ignition system. I changed batteries and tested alt and I can get it start now if I hold WOT when I have this issue but it didn't fix it. Things I've changed: (just in general after/during this issue) Spark plugs, fuel pump, vacuum lines, battery, MSD distributor, 52mm BBK throttle body with different TPS/IAC.. I had problem prior, and still have currently after changing these things.
I have good fuel pressure, holds 40psi when priming the system and letting truck sit, so I don't think an injector is leaking down?? I recently installed a remote start and half the time the truck wont start using it unless it's first thing in the AM or after 8 hours of work.
